First, ION Television continues to expand its programming line-up with high-quality content with the acquisition of reruns of the popular TNT drama series, Leverage from Electric Entertainment. ION Television, a top-10 rated network, has licensed the off-network rights to all seasons of Leverage. The series will begin airing on ION Television in summer 2012.
The series will enter its fifth season on TNT by the time ION starts airing reruns. Before that, the fourth season will continue with the second batch of episodes starting Sunday, Nov. 27 on TNT. Leverage follows a five-person team: a thief, a grifter, a hacker, a retrieval specialist, and their leader, former insurance investigator Nathan Ford (Academy Award Winner(R) Timothy Hutton), who use their skills to right corporate and governmental injustices inflicted on ordinary citizens. The first half of season four has averaged more than 4.8 million viewers, up 10% over season three, with 1.9 million adults 18-49 (+6%) and 2.3 million adults 25-54 (+9%).
The Leverage deal comes on the heels of ION's recent acquisition of cable's other hit series Psych, Monk and House, signifying ION as a viable after-market platform for cable net productions. The hit series also joins ION Television's primetime schedule of the popular off-net series Without a Trace, Criminal Minds, Ghost Whisperer and ION's first original police drama Flashpoint, which will join the network soon.

Meanwhile, Lifetime has picked up all-new episodes of John Walsh's pioneering series America's Most Wanted, television's top crime-fighting show that will return for its 25th season later this year on Lifetime. Hosted and executive produced by Walsh, America's Most Wanted has become one of the most important programs on television, having played a major role in the capture of more than 1,100 fugitives in the U.S. and 30 countries, including 17 on the FBI's Ten Most Wanted List, and rescue of 61 children and missing persons since its launch in 1988.
The series was not placed on the Fox schedule this fall, but Fox had scheduled quarterly two-hour specials, the first of which is slated to air on Saturday, Oct. 29. As of now, that is still on the schedule on Fox, but it is unclear if there will be any other specials as originally planned. The series stopped airing as a regular on Fox this past June.
